Back in 07 my 2 month old 220 was hit at night by a drunk 21 year old and then ran off. Made a police report that night, I/ we found the boat the next day called police and when they made contact with them the first question they asked was if we're all ok. Admitted to not calling that night because his parents told him not to, it was best to wait and see. Parents were big money insurance people and took almost a year in court to receive my deductible out of them. Has ruined night boating for my wife ever since.
